Abellio 3056

3055
Back to home page Back to Main Index Back to Transport UK Index
3057
3056 LV 24 EUP Wt StDk Elr SC5DDREXU24000580 Wt AV370 H40/20D

Imperial Wharf, Fulham
21st April 2024

Back to Main Index Back to Transport UK Index Back to home page